hcf(87, 102) = 3.
factorization method:
87 = 3 x 29
102 = 2 x 3 x 17
hcf = 3
Same as the greatest common factor of 87 and 15 (15 is the remainder of the division of 102 by 87).

To find the greatest common factor, or GCF, you must first identify the factors for each number.For 348, its factors are 1, 2, 3, 4, 6, 12, 29, 58, 87, 116, 174 and 348.For 1024, its factors are 1, 2, 4, 8, 16, 64, 128, 256, 512, and 1024.4 is the highest (or greatest) factor they have in common, so the GCF for 348 and 1024 is 4.

One way to determine the greatest common factor is to find all the factors of the numbers and compare them. The factors of 29 are 1 and 29.The factors of 87 are 1, 3, 29, and 87.The common factors are 1 and 29. Therefore, the greatest common factor is 29.The greatest common factor can also be calculated by identifying the common prime factors and multiplying them together. The prime factor of 29 is 29.The prime factors of 87 are 3 and 29.The prime factors in common are a single 29, so the greatest common factor is 29. == == 29 is a prime number so its only factors are 1 and 29.
